Output 48609274cfd40b51fa8f0b08d0cdd16c7c0b2b0f77e51f126606d8c2cdf97ecc:0

value
2370558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d34fe88a58270626b002e398a00f910084661b5b OP_EQUAL
address
3LxLE9fctea2wgeWBa63eQzfP1B9BdmJXr
transaction
48609274cfd40b51fa8f0b08d0cdd16c7c0b2b0f77e51f126606d8c2cdf97ecc
confirmations
40290
spent
true